Front Waveguide for Turbochef Part# TBCNGC-3016

Details
This quality replacement Front Waveguide is a precision-stamped metal channel assembly for TurboChef NGC and Tornado countertop rapid-cook ovens, directing microwave energy from the magnetron feed point into the front section of the cook chamber to ensure uniform microwave energy distribution throughout the cavity. The waveguide's geometry is engineered to match the NGC/Tornado cavity dimensions, controlling the mode pattern of microwave energy to achieve the even, rapid energy coupling into food that is central to TurboChef's 10–15x speed advantage over conventional ovens. Using the waveguide preserves the specific energy distribution profile the oven's cook algorithms are calibrated to, preventing under- or over-exposure zones that cause inconsistent product quality.
Waveguide damage in the NGC and Tornado typically results from grease carbonization on the waveguide interior surface, arcing caused by metal fragments or foil entering the cavity, and physical deformation from cleaning tool impacts; arcing events are particularly destructive, burning pits or holes into the waveguide metal that further concentrate microwave energy at the damage site and accelerate the damage in a progressive cycle. Symptoms of waveguide degradation include arcing sounds or visible sparks during cooking, uneven or slow cooking performance, burning odors from carbonized grease, and microwave output faults indicated on the control display. Replacing the front waveguide eliminates the arcing source, restores uniform energy distribution, and stops the progressive cavity damage that an arcing waveguide can inflict.
Waveguide replacement requires removing the waveguide cover and any associated mounting hardware inside the cook chamber; clean all surfaces of the cavity and magnetron feed area thoroughly before installing the new waveguide to remove carbon deposits that could initiate new arcing. Inspect the waveguide cover for damage at the same time, replacing it if any burns or deformation are present, as a damaged cover allows grease to reach the waveguide surface and restart the contamination cycle. Replace the front waveguide at the first sign of arcing or burn damage—do not continue operating with a damaged waveguide as this can cause escalating cavity damage and magnetron failure. Follow installation with a test cook and visual inspection through the door window to confirm no arcing is present.
